How To Remove Power & Heated Front Seats
I need to remove my drivers seat for some leather repair on my 1985. My front seats are both 8 way power and heated. I removed all 6 hex head bolts holding the seats to the floor without any problem. However, I'm not sure how to disconnect the wires under the seat. There appears to be one bundle of several wires attached somehow in the middle of the seat and one additional set of two wires toward the back of the seat with an obvious connector that I should be able to separate.
My problem is how to remove the larger bundle of wires going to the middle of the seat. It looks like there may be a plug or connector supported by a metal bracket that might separate but I'm not sure. Can anyone who has done this before tell me how to approach removing the larger bundle of wires? Thanks. Dom |
there's a connector... just loosen the front bolts of the rail a bit, but leave em in the thread a little bit
Slide the seat forward, remove rear bolts completely slide back seat remove front bolts completely , gently tip seat backwards , remove connector |
It just pulls right off. Easy to disconnect when the seat is in. Make sure you reconnect it BEFORE bolting the seat back up unless you have micro-hands ;)
